3sgte and 3sfe block compatibility

My celica needs a new block because the current one is scored, and I cant afford to get it bored and new oversized pistons and rods etc, so I figured just replace the block. It is an st185, with a gen 2 3sgte. can i use the block off a 3sfe?

Bad idea, 3sfe's hate boost. You'll spend as much or more money on making the 3sfe hold boost than rebuilding the 3sgte or replace if need be.

The gte was designed for boost, high revs, and racing, where as the fe was intended for grocery getting and fuel economy.
